Light-weight Waterproof Materials for Backpacking




Every backpacker eventually faces the same trade-off: remaining completely dry versus staying light. Standard waterproofing usually meant hefty rubberized materials or thick finishes that added undesirable bulk to a pack. Thankfully, materials scientific research has actually caught up with the requirements of long-distance walkers, thru-trekkers, and weekend travelers alike. Today's gear market provides a range of textiles that shed water effectively while barely signing up on a scale. Understanding these products can aid you make smarter choices when furnishing your following trip.

Why Weight and Waterproofing Usually Compete



Waterproof performance traditionally relied on dense, snugly woven fabrics or hefty laminated layers. The thicker the barrier, the better it resisted water penetration, but the compromise was added ounces that accumulate swiftly across a tent, rain coat, pack cover, and completely dry bags. For backpackers counting every gram, this produced a discouraging problem. Newer textile technologies have mainly resolved this by using thinner membranes, tighter weaves, and advanced coatings that achieve high hydrostatic head scores without the mass of older materials.

Dyneema Compound Textile (DCF)



Previously called Cuben Fiber, Dyneema Compound Material has actually come to be a favored amongst ultralight backpackers. It's built from a grid of ultra-high-molecular-weight polyethylene fibers sandwiched between layers of polyester movie. The outcome is a material that is incredibly strong about its weight, totally water-proof naturally instead of through an included finish, and immune to stretching also when damp. DCF is typically utilized in tents, knapsacks, and things sacks. Its primary downsides are price and a tendency to crinkle loudly, but also for those chasing after the lightest possible base weight, it's often worth the financial investment.

Silicone-Coated Nylon (Silnylon)



Silnylon has long been a staple in the ultralight community. Nylon fabric is fertilized with silicone on one or both sides, creating a waterproof obstacle that stays flexible and packs down little. It's substantially less costly than Dyneema and still offers a strong weight-to-durability ratio. One quirk worth noting is that silnylon can extend when wet, which often calls for re-tensioning guylines on a tent overnight. In spite of this small aggravation, it continues to be among the most affordable water resistant materials offered for tarpaulins, outdoor tents flies, and pack linings.

Polyurethane-Coated Fabrics



Polyurethane (PU) layers are related to nylon or polyester to develop a water-proof layer that's a little heavier than silicone treatments but frequently much more abrasion-resistant. PU-coated materials are widely used in budget-friendly rain gear and pack covers. While not as cutting-edge as DCF or silnylon, they stay a trustworthy, inexpensive option for backpackers who don't require to cut every feasible gram however still desire reputable protection from the components.

ePTFE Membranes (Gore-Tex and Comparable)



Enhanced polytetrafluoroethylene, the modern technology behind Gore-Tex, functions in a different way than covered materials. Rather than simply blocking water, the membrane layer contains microscopic pores that are also tiny for water beads to go through but large sufficient to allow water vapor escape. This makes it a favorite for rainfall jackets and footwear where breathability matters as high as waterproofing. Newer generations of these membranes have come to be thinner and lighter without giving up performance, closing the gap with easier waterproof-only fabrics.

Recycled and Bio-Based Alternatives



Sustainability has actually ended up being an expanding emphasis in outdoor gear production, and water-proof textiles are no exception. Recycled polyester and nylon fabrics, typically combined with PFC-free water-proof coverings, now do equally to their typical counterparts. Some brand names are likewise trying out bio-based membranes stemmed from camp lights plant products as alternatives to petroleum-based options. While these materials are still catching up in raw efficiency metrics, they stand for an important shift toward minimizing the ecological impact of backpacking equipment.

Picking the Right Material for Your Journey



The best waterproof material depends on your concerns. Thru-hikers chasing after the lowest possible base weight usually gravitate toward DCF despite its higher price. Budget-conscious backpackers might locate silnylon or PU-coated nylon flawlessly ample for weekend trips. Those hiking in chillier, wetter climates where breathability prevents overheating and condensation could focus on ePTFE membrane layers for coats, even if they're coupled with lighter silnylon or DCF for sanctuaries and packs.
